#185633 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#185633 is composed of 9.4% red, 33.7% green and 20%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 72.1% cyan, 0% magenta, 40.7% yellow and 66.3% black. It has a hue angle of 146.1 degrees, a saturation of 56.4% and a lightness of 21.6%. #185633 color hex could be obtained by blending #30ac66 with #000000. Closest websafe color is: #006633.

#185633 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#185633 has RGB values of R:24, G:86, B:51 and CMYK values of C:0.72, M:0, Y:0.41, K:0.66. Its decimal value is 1594931.
